💡 Affiliate Spotlight on When Push Comes to Shove

We sat down with Nickita Starck, founder of World Council for Health affiliate When Push Comes to Shove, to learn more about the organization.

When Push Comes To Shove is a maternity service specializing in birth physiology and birthrights. Based in the UK and available in five countries (and counting), it offers birth education and advocacy for midwives, doulas, birth keepers, and families.
